Colorado Bureau of Investigation Assists La Junta Police Department with Homicide Investigation
February 16, 2026– CBI – La Junta, CO – The Colorado Bureau of Investigation (CBI) provided assistance to the La Junta Police Department (LJPD), the lead agency, in a homicide investigation that resulted in the arrest of an 18-year old suspect on February 14, 2026. Lamar Community College and Colorado Small Business Development Center Announce Soft Opening of Innovate and Makerspace
Lamar Community College (LCC), in partnership with the Colorado Small Business Development Center (SBDC) serving East Colorado, is proud to announce the soft opening of the Innovate and Makerspace, a new hub for creativity, innovation, and small business development located on the LCC campus.
